FireFox位于"从......传输数据"或"读取......"

bry*_*ook 10 asp.net firefox selenium

我正在使用Selenium为网站构建一些功能测试,并且我陷入了一个奇怪的浏览器问题,页面似乎永远不会完成加载.状态栏显示"从...传输数据"或"读取...".

由于页面永远不会完成加载,我的selenium测试超时.

这个问题似乎只发生在FireFox上. 我们的测试依靠FireFox*chrome来测试文件上传,因此FireFox对我们的测试策略至关重要.

我已经检查了FireBug和Fiddler,但我没有看到任何不完整的长期运行请求.所有请求都包含正常响应代码(无404错误).

我应该怎么看才能解决这个问题?

  • 文档类型?
  • 标记无效?
  • 低级FireFox设置?
  • 注册表黑客?
  • IIS设置?

虽然解决这个星球的问题会很棒,但我只需要为我的测试解决问题.

如果它有帮助,它是一个基于MOSS的.NET 3.5解决方案,我们正在使用带有sifr的Flash.我们的标记是遗留的(它是一个MOSS站点)所以它的边缘有点粗糙.

小智 5

这是Firefox中的一个已知错误:https://bugzilla.mozilla.org/show_bug.cgi?id = 388311

如果您认为该错误与您的情况相关,请考虑在bugzilla中投票.


bry*_*ook 3

我不想回答我自己的问题,但在开发人员开始删除无效标记后,问题自行消失了,未关闭的表或没有表的 TR 通常很糟糕。